**Audit Item 14 — Scheduler Hook Validation.** Plugin authors extending the SproutCycle watering scheduler must confirm that custom hooks respect the global moisture-threshold override. Verify that your plugin does not schedule watering events during the maintenance window defined in the core config, and that failed hardware callbacks are retried no more than three times. Plugins failing this check will be delisted from the Verdara registry. Direct all questions about this item to the responsible owner named below.

approver of bagug-bagag = Holael Pramir

**Vendor note — donation-receipt mailer**

Reviewer: the GivingPost receipt mailer now routes through our new vendor, Postwren, under a twelve-month contract. Please verify that retry behavior matches their documented limits (three attempts, exponential backoff) and that the sandbox flag is stripped before merge to main. Any deviation from the signed service terms must be flagged. Questions about the contract scope should go to our vendor liaison at the address below.

escalation mailbox, yajeg-bageg: quenax.olidor@lumiccorp.internal

Quick note on canary gating for the Peltwright deploy API. A canary only graduates if error rate stays under 0.5% and p95 latency within 10% of baseline for thirty minutes; otherwise the gate auto-rolls back, no human override without a signed waiver. Security-relevant bit: gating decisions are logged immutably, and the gate service itself can't push code, only block it. You can audit gate decisions via the read-only decisions endpoint. To query it from the review environment, authenticate with the key below.

gateway credential: kto3_qfe

**Handover: Pagination in the Verdane Public API**

Taking over from the previous owner: the list endpoints use cursor-based pagination, not offsets. Cursors are opaque, expire after 24 hours, and break if clients sort by mutable fields — that's the most common support ticket. There's a pending proposal to add stable sort keys to the orders endpoint; it's half-reviewed. Known edge cases, cursor format notes, and the migration plan are all collected on the internal page below.

operations page: https://jira.qorvelsys.internal/browse/pages/browse/pages